Before anything goes to the Ivy Materials Utilization Center, Albemarle Moving's crew sorts every load for donation potential. Furniture in good condition, working appliances, tools, kitchen items, and household goods go to Habitat for Humanity ReStore at 1221 Harris Street or directly to Central Virginia families. On average, 65%+ of every load is donated or recycled before disposal.
